摘要
随着人们生活方式的变化,颈椎病的发病年龄已近逐渐年轻化。神经根型颈椎病(Cervical Spondylotic Radiculopathy,CSR)的颈椎病中最常见,约占50%以上,主要表现为肩、背部疼痛、上肢及手指的放射性疼痛、麻木、无力。近年来,随着影像学及神经电生理技术的发展,尤其是电生理检查的不断进步,为神经根型颈椎病的诊断提供了更多的方法。本文就CSR的诊断方法及进展进行综述。
